Z-Wave & Matter Solution: Current Supply in China, Current Challenges, and Future Opportunities

In the global smart home market, Z-Wave and Matter are emerging as key connectivity protocols, especially in North America and Europe. However, the current supply of Z-Wave and Matter devices remains limited, with high MOQs (Minimum Order Quantities) and relatively high costs. Why is this the case? And for the smart window and door industry, does this present a challenge—or an opportunity?


1. The Current State of Z-Wave & Matter: Why Are They Hard to Source?

(1) Global Market Demand Differences

  • Z-Wave is primarily popular in North America and Europe, where many smart home integrators and manufacturers prefer it for reliability and security. However, demand for Z-Wave in China and other emerging markets is minimal, leading to limited production capacity and higher MOQs.
  • Matter, while having great potential, is still in its early stages. Many manufacturers are taking a wait-and-see approach, resulting in fewer available products and higher costs.

(2) Supply Chain Challenges

  • Z-Wave is dominated by Silicon Labs (SiLabs), which controls the chipsets, modules, and certification process—driving up costs and making it less attractive for Chinese manufacturers.
  • Matter relies on Wi-Fi and Thread protocols, but Thread-based solutions have yet to achieve mass adoption, making development and production more expensive.
  • Certification for both Z-Wave and Matter adds extra costs, further increasing the pricing and MOQs required by suppliers.

(3) Competitive Landscape

Compared to Wi-Fi and Zigbee solutions, Z-Wave and Matter are currently more expensive and have a less mature supply chain. The Wi-Fi and Zigbee market is highly competitive, with lower prices and a wider variety of products, making them the dominant choice for manufacturers.

3. Future Outlook: The Potential of Z-Wave & Matter

While Z-Wave and Matter solutions are still limited in China, their future looks promising:

Z-Wave remains a dominant protocol in high-end and customized smart home solutions, particularly in North America and Europe.

Matter, backed by Apple, Google, Amazon, and the CSA (formerly Zigbee Alliance), is set to reduce fragmentation and improve interoperability.

As demand grows, supply chains will optimize, costs will decrease, and MOQs will become more flexible—making Z-Wave and Matter more accessible.
